The Future of Political Cartoonists

At least from the point of view of an editorial cartoonist from another hemisphere ....

New Zealand TV interviewer Paul Henry talks to NZ editorial cartoonist Tom Scott (here's a link to PDF bio page for him) in the below video upon the occasion of the Cartooning for Peace conference.

How would you react if an interviewer asked you," ... [Cartoons] seem -- if you don't mind me saying -- to be sort of quite hokey, in a way, and yet they are enduring, in a way, aren't they?"

Tom Scott holds his own and the only thing I disagreed with was the idea that cartoons are hokey. There are more cartoons and more readers of cartoons than any other time in history!
